Welcome to the world of Snowflake Time Travel and Data Recovery! If you're a beginner looking to understand how Snowflake can help you manage and recover your data effortlessly, you're in the right place. This guide will walk you through the current capabilities and features of Snowflake's unique Time Travel feature as of November 2025.
In this post, we'll cover everything from the basics to the latest updates and practical steps you can take to leverage Snowflake's data recovery feature effectively. Let's dive in and explore how you can make the most of this technology.
📚 Table of Contents
- What is Snowflake Time Travel?
- Latest Updates & Features (November 2025)
- How It Works / Step-by-Step
- Benefits of Snowflake Time Travel
- Drawbacks / Risks
- Example / Comparison Table
- Common Mistakes & How to Avoid
- FAQs on Snowflake Time Travel
- Key Takeaways
- Conclusion / Final Thoughts
- Useful Resources
- Related Posts
What is Snowflake Time Travel?
Snowflake Time Travel is a powerful feature within the Snowflake data platform that allows users to access historical data and recover data from previous states. Imagine being able to rewind your data to a specific point in time—it’s like having a time machine for data management. As of November 2025, Snowflake has released version 7.3, which enhances Time Travel capabilities with extended data retention periods.
Latest Updates & Features (November 2025)
- Extended Data Retention: Version 7.3 allows up to 120 days of data retention, giving users more flexibility.
- Improved Query Performance: Enhanced query optimization for faster data retrieval.
- Automated Recovery Alerts: New alert system to notify users of potential data recovery issues.
- Cross-Region Time Travel: Access historical data across different geographical regions seamlessly.
- Enhanced Security Protocols: New encryption standards for better data protection.
How It Works / Step-by-Step
- Enable Time Travel: Ensure your Snowflake account has Time Travel enabled.
- Set Retention Period: Define how long you want your historical data to be retained.
- Query Historical Data: Use the
ATorBEFOREclause in your SQL queries to access past data. - Recover Data: Use the
UNDROPcommand to recover deleted data. - Monitor Usage: Regularly check data retention settings and usage to optimize performance.
Benefits of Snowflake Time Travel
- Data Recovery: Quickly recover lost or deleted data without hassle.
- Audit and Compliance: Maintain data history for compliance with regulatory requirements.
- Error Correction: Easily revert to previous data states to correct errors.
- Improved Data Management: Manage data changes with transparency and control.
- Cost Efficiency: Avoid costs associated with external backup solutions.
Drawbacks / Risks
- Increased Storage Costs: Longer retention periods may increase storage requirements.
- Complex Configuration: Setting up Time Travel correctly can be challenging for beginners.
- Potential Security Risks: Ensure data access controls are strictly managed to prevent unauthorized access.
Example / Comparison Table
| Feature | Snowflake Time Travel | Traditional DW | Pros/Cons |
|---|---|---|---|
| Data Retention | Up to 120 days | Limited | More flexible in Snowflake |
| Query Performance | Optimized | Variable | Faster in Snowflake |
| Cross-Region Access | Yes | No | Snowflake offers more |
| Setup Complexity | Moderate | High | Easier with Snowflake |
📢 Share this post
Found this helpful? Share it with your network!
MSBI Dev
Data Engineering Expert & BI Developer
Passionate about helping businesses unlock the power of their data through modern BI and data engineering solutions. Follow for the latest trends in Snowflake, Tableau, Power BI, and cloud data platforms.
No comments:
Post a Comment